The Flaming Lips - Performance of The Abandoned Hospital Ship at SXSW 2015
In March 2015, The Flaming Lips took the stage at ACL Live during SXSW, delivering a high-energy performance of 'The Abandoned Hospital Ship.' This was right after their 2013 album, 'The Terror,' which showcased their willingness to explore darker and more experimental soundscapes. The band has always had a flair for the unusual, and this live show was no exception, blending their eclectic style with engaging visuals – a hallmark of their concerts. Interestingly, 'The Terror' was notable for being more introspective compared to their earlier work, reflecting a period of personal growth for frontman Wayne Coyne. This performance, amidst the vibrant SXSW atmosphere, exemplified their ability to connect emotionally with the audience while pushing creative boundaries.
